Just when I thought
the tears were gone,
when I knew today
I wouldn't cry, but smile
at the love and life
that God took away
when he stole Miss Ginger.
And then I read her
student's poetry.
And the tears are covering
this keyboard again.
I am angry at God.
And please,
don't ask me
not to be.
Maybe next week.
Maybe when I see
through the pain
I know the family
and friends
must endure.
Don't ask me
not to cry.
Not yet.
It's too soon.
